Abstrak:
The entrepreneurship adaptation program by BAZNAS Kota Jambi has shown its ability to adjust to field conditions, including through directives issued by the Mayor of Jambi. This study uses a descriptive qualitative method aiming to explore: the implementation of the adapted entrepreneurship program for MSMEs in alleviating poverty, the supporting factors, and how the program contributes to poverty reduction efforts. The findings indicate that BAZNAS Kota Jambi has distributed productive zakat funds through the "Jambi Kota Mandiri" program to mustahik in the form of business capital or sales goods. However, only 20% of total zakat funds are currently allocated for productive purposes, while 80% remain allocated to consumptive assistance. This is contrary to the recommendation from BAZNAS Central, which suggests that 70% of zakat funds should be used productively to support poverty alleviation. Supporting factors for successful entrepreneurship among mustahik include strong human resources, entrepreneurial soft skills, motivation, regulatory support from BAZNAS, and social capital. However, the absence of consistent monitoring and evaluation prevents assessing whether the program can sustainably transform mustahik into muzakki. Without proper follow-up, the program risks reverting to one-time consumptive assistance. Therefore, strategic improvements and oversight mechanisms are necessary to enhance the program’s effectiveness and sustainability.

Abstrak:
Competition for new student admissions in schools across Indonesia has recently become a topic of considerable interest. A school's strategy in implementing the New Student Admission Program (PPDB) is one of the key factors determining the success of its marketing efforts. In reality, inadequate PPDB strategies often prove detrimental to some schools. SD Muhammadiyah 1 Ngaglik is one example of an elementary school that has successfully executed its PPDB with the right strategy. The purpose of this study is to describe and analyze the PPDB strategy at SD Muhammadiyah 1 Ngaglik. This research employs a qualitative approach with a descriptive design. The study was conducted at SD Muhammadiyah 1 Ngaglik during the 2024 PPDB period. The research data sources include the school principal, the PPDB coordinator, three PPDB committee members, and three parents of new students. Data collection techniques involve interviews, observations, and documentation using interview guidelines, observation guides, and documentation checklists. The triangulation method applied includes data source triangulation reinforced by technique triangulation. The findings of this study reveal that: 1) The PPDB strategy at SD Muhammadiyah 1 Ngaglik begins with the planning stage, which includes environmental analysis, collaboration planning, determining the PPDB committee, and planning for printed and digital promotions as well as funding, 2) The implementation stage involves signing Memorandums of Understanding (MoUs) with kindergartens, organizing supporting activities, and promoting the program through print and digital media, 3) Monitoring the implementation of PPDB is carried out through regular meetings to discuss achievements, challenges, and solutions, 4) Evaluation is conducted to assess the success of the PPDB, including evaluation meetings, planning for the next year's PPDB, and follow-up actions.

Abstrak:
This research compares the financial performance of insurance companies in Indonesia using the Du Pont method, identifies the determinants of differences in profitability and efficiency, and provides strategic recommendations. The methodology involves analyzing the 2023 audited financial statements of PT Asuransi Dayin Mitra Tbk and PT Asuransi Bintang Tbk as samples, applying the Du Pont method, financial ratios, and qualitative analysis. The results reveal a significant difference in profitability, with PT Asuransi Dayin Mitra Tbk excelling in net profit margin, asset turnover, and a conservative capital structure, while PT Asuransi Bintang Tbk outperforms in underwriting risk management, claims handling, and aggressive marketing strategies. Strategic recommendations include maintaining strengths, exploring revenue growth, enhancing cost efficiency, and adjusting capital structure. This research contributes to understanding the dynamics of financial performance in the Indonesian insurance industry.

Abstrak:
One of the training programs that can increase economic income is making Aromatherapy candles, namely by utilizing used cooking oil waste, taking into account that the available resources are easy to obtain and also ingredients that can be used every day. The aim of this community service is to empower young housewives, young men and women and students around residential areas to produce Aromatherapy candle products from used cooking oil and increase community knowledge about how to make Aromatherapy candles using environmentally friendly raw materials. The method of implementing this training is a direct demonstration of aromatherapy candle making techniques using prepared materials and how to make them. The results of the training show the potential for significant social change, both in material (candle production) and non-material (change in mindset) aspects. Changes in participants' mindsets about waste and entrepreneurship reflect a transformative learning process.

Abstrak:
This research discusses the importance of educational character in preventing bullying in educational units. Character education is an educational system whose learning can influence everyone, especially education to demonstrate moral values, ethics and civic attitudes towards oneself and others. However, character education is currently a challenge in its implementation, especially with the rise of problems such as verbal and non-verbal bullying among students. Moreover, now the problem of bullying does not only occur in ordinary schools, but can also occur in international schools. One of the factors is a lack of ability to control behavior, an inability to manage emotions which ultimately triggers a desire for revenge in order to adapt to the environment. The strategies needed to overcome bullying include teacher sensitivity towards students, creating a safe atmosphere, forming an anti-bullying team, and conducting outreach about the dangers of bullying.

Abstrak:
The correlation between environmental ethics and societal behavior has become an increasingly important subject in the context of environmental conservation. This article presents a literature review of the relationship between individual environmental ethics and community behavior in the context of environmental conservation efforts. Through searching various journals and related publications, we identified key themes, findings and trends in this research. Research shows that environmental ethical values, environmental awareness, and social norms play a key role in shaping individual and collective behavior towards the environment. Factors such as education, personal experiences, and social pressures also influence how individuals and societies respond to environmental issues. Policy implications and suggestions for future research are also discussed.

Abstrak:
This research aims to formulate a social forestry management strategy for HKm Sulian Besar in Keban Jati Village, Air Nipis District, South Bengkulu Regency. This research was carried out from July to August 2024 in Keban Jati Village, Air Nipis District, South Bengkulu Regency, Bengkulu Province. The research location was carried out in the Sulian Besar Community Forest. This research uses a combination method (mixed) dominantly qualitative and less dominantly quantitative. To recommend strategies for community forest management (HKm) that have achieved economic, social and ecological and institutional benefits by identifying using SWOT analysis to analyze various factors systematically. The position of the community forest management strategy in HKm Sulian Besar, Keban Jati Village, Air Nipis District, South Bengkulu Regency is in quadrant III, namely the turn around strategy where the implementation of the social forestry program of the community forest scheme has great opportunities but there are internal weaknesses so you have to choose the right strategy so that weaknesses are not reduce the odds. Alternative strategies that can be implemented include restructuring group institutions, increasing institutional, technical and marketing capacity, improving cultivation patterns and conducting effective NTFP marketing.

Abstrak:
Reducing the area of agricultural areas, especially paddy fields into palm oil plantations in the use of space in Mukomuko Regency, has raised concerns about the impact of these changes, namely the decline in rice productivity, which if allowed to drag on could lead to food insecurity due to the decreasing number of functional paddy fields. into oil palm plantations, especially in areas that are designated as agropolitan in the Mukomuko Regency spatial planning. Time and Place of Research: Research was conducted from October to November 2023 in Muko-Muko Regency, Bengkulu Province. To find out the strategy for managing land conversion, SWOT analysis is used. The results of the research show that the position of controlling the conversion of wetland agricultural land is in quadrant I, namely the position with an aggressive strategy (S-O). In this case the recommended strategy is to utilize strengths to take advantage of existing opportunities. Alternative strategies that can be implemented by policy makers, in this case the Mukomuko district government, to prevent the conversion of rice land to oil palm are clear regulations and establishing clear rice field zones in spatial plans, improving government policies in the farming sector, improving institutions in the farming sector, empowerment and socialization regarding land conversion regulations and improving agricultural facilities and infrastructure
